QUICK CHICKEN MADRAS
Ingredients
- 4 skinless
- boneless chicken breasts or thighs
- ½ lemon
- juice only
- 1 tsp garam masala
- salt
- 2 tbsp vegetable oil or ghee (clarified butter)
- 1 large onion
- finely chopped
- ready-made madras curry paste
- 1-2 tbsp for mild
- 3 tbsp for medium-hot
- and 4-5 tbsp for hot
- 1x400g can chopped tomatoes
- 50g/2oz desiccated coconut
- small handful of fresh coriander
- chopped
Directions
- Cut the chicken into bite-size pieces and mix with the lemon juice
- and garam masala and season with salt.
- Heat the oil or ghee in a deep frying pan or saucepan over a medium heat and cook the onion for 6-7 minutes until softened and becoming golden. Add the chicken and fry for 3-4 minutes until it has become opaque in colour. Stir in the Madras paste and cook for a couple of minutes before adding the chopped tomatoes and coconut. Cover with a lid and leave to simmer gently for about 20 minutes. Stir in the chopped coriander and serve straight away with naan bread.
